## Deployment

Following the stale-cache incident in the Lanternfall release, we changed how deploys invalidate the edge cache. The deploy script now purges cache keys before the new pods go live, not after, which closes the window where users could see mismatched assets. Support should know that a deploy now takes roughly four minutes longer. The deploy job runs with the following configuration values.

deployment values, yahag-tawef:
ZORWYN_HOST=zorwyn.tolvaqlabs.internal
ZORWYN_PORT=9300

## Deploying the Gatewick Proctor Queue

Deploys are pretty painless: push to main, wait for the pipeline, then watch the queue drain dashboard for five minutes. If candidates pile up mid-exam, roll back first and ask questions later — the queue replays safely. Everything the workers care about lives in one config block, shown here for reference.

settings of bafof-yagef:
JOROX_PIN=8740
JOROX_TENANT=pelox
JOROX_METRICS_HOST=metrics.jorox.qorvelworks.internal
JOROX_SEAL=seal_c78f63c1
JOROX_STANDBY_TEAM=norax

Subject: Quickstore 4.2 — bloom filter now fronts the KV layer

Plugin authors: starting with this release, Quickstore places a bloom filter ahead of the key-value store. Negative lookups return faster; false positives fall through safely. No API changes are required on your side. Verify your plugin against the staging build referenced below.

session token of fahif-tadup = htk3_9c7